End of Sequestration

Section 1

October 6, 2020

The post-move-in sequestration period has completed and may now move within your community, following all campus directives for COVID-prevention. 

**Important Note: Students who are currently in quarantine must remain in place and continue to follow quarantine guidelines until they are notified that their quarantine is completed.**

Students released from sequestration should continue to:

1. Practice the three basics of COVID prevention: wear a face-covering outside of your room, maintain a physical distance of six feet or more, and frequently wash your hands.

2. Complete the Daily Symptom Check - https://students.uci.edu/daily-symptom-check.html

3. No guests or visitors in the hall/house or room. No one is permitted in your room except you. No one who lives outside your hall/house is allowed to enter the building.

4. No In-person gatherings except for activities sponsored by your housing community and carefully designed to conform to campus requirements listed in the Chancellor’s Executive Directive, issued on July 21, 2020.

5. Schedule their routine COVID test at one of the campus testing centers.

 We hope you will enjoy getting outside and moving about the campus with a bit more freedom, but we urge you to continue to follow all public health guidelines issued by the campus.*  Failure to comply with these requirements will result in disciplinary action. Some restrictions will continue beyond the sequestration period. Learn more about Student Housing COVID-related policies and other Student Housing policies on the Student Housing website.

*Please note that community center amenities, fitness centers, study areas, outdoor courtyards and BBQ areas will remain temporarily closed.  We will inform you once these areas can reopen for use (within university policies, the Chancellor’s Executive Directives and city/county guidelines).
